Can India match China’s lead in solar manufacturing?
Product Details: Solar PV modules manufactured in India and China.
Technical Parameters:
– Production cost in China: $0.15 / watt
– Production cost in India: $0.27 / watt
Application Scenarios:
– Residential solar installations
– Large-scale solar power generation
Pros:
– Government incentives for solar manufacturing in India
– Lower production costs in China due to optimized infrastructure
Cons:
– India’s solar manufacturing sector relies on imported components
– Higher raw material costs in India compared to imports

China’s Solar Manufacturing Capacity Expands by 1,500 GW
Product Details: Polysilicon, silicon wafers, solar cells, and modules produced in China with significant expansion plans.
Technical Parameters:
– Polysilicon production: 760,000 tons
– Silicon wafer production: 442 GW
– Total cell and module production expansion: 1,100.6 GW
Application Scenarios:
– Solar energy generation
– Photovoltaic systems in residential and commercial applications
Pros:
– Significant cost reduction in polysilicon materials
– Increased production capacity for solar components
Cons:
– Potential overproduction leading to market saturation
– Investment drop in polysilicon production

Frequently Asked Questions (FAQs)
What are solar module fabrication factories in China?
Solar module fabrication factories in China are facilities that manufacture solar panels. They produce photovoltaic cells and assemble them into modules that convert sunlight into electricity. China is a global leader in solar manufacturing, known for its advanced technology and large-scale production capabilities.
How do I choose a reliable solar module factory in China?
To choose a reliable factory, look for certifications like ISO and IEC, check their production capacity, and read customer reviews. It’s also helpful to visit the factory if possible or request a virtual tour to assess their operations and quality control processes.
What is the typical production capacity of these factories?
The production capacity of solar module factories in China varies widely, with some large-scale manufacturers producing several gigawatts of solar panels annually. Smaller factories may produce less, but they often focus on niche markets or specialized products.
What are the common materials used in solar module fabrication?
Common materials include silicon for photovoltaic cells, glass for the front cover, and aluminum for the frame. Additionally, encapsulants and back sheets are used to protect the cells and enhance durability, ensuring the modules can withstand environmental conditions.
What are the environmental regulations for solar module factories in China?
Solar module factories in China must comply with various environmental regulations, including waste management and emissions standards. The government has been increasingly enforcing stricter regulations to promote sustainable practices and reduce pollution in the manufacturing process.
